A Leading Utilities Contractor is looking for a Procurement Manager to join their team based from any regional UK office.
The main objective of the role is to develop and implement procurement strategies for national energy projects.
Responsibilities- Lead and develop a small buying team.
- Create and improve procurement processes that support business objectives.
- Deliver the procurement requirements of senior internal stakeholders.
- Deliver cost savings, efficiency and quality improvements across the procurement function.
- Support the Head of Procurement with delivery a functional change programme.

Further DetailsPortfolio of energy projects involving a combination of civil engineering and electrical works, as well as balance of plant installations.
Our client provides solutions across private networks, renewable energy, battery energy storage solutions (BESS), data centres, HVDC, and electric vehicle charging infrastructure.
Working on numerous live projects with a £2bn+ secured pipeline of work over the next 3 years.
Candidate RequirementsOur client is looking for Procurement Managers looking for a career move. They are also keen to speak with experienced Senior Buyers looking for career progression.
You will have 5+ years experience delivering strategic procurement across infrastructure projects for any main contractor or large subcontractor.
Ideally you will have some experience of delivering subcontract procurement, however this is not essential and training will be provided.
Ideally you will have some experience of leading small teams of procurement personnel.
